What is subscript in HTML with example?
The HTML tag defines subscript text in an HTML document. For example, in the chemical formula CO2, the number 2 is rendered as subscript which has a smaller font and appears with a lowered baseline. This tag is also commonly referred to as the element.
What is sub element in HTML?
: The Subscript element. The HTML element specifies inline text which should be displayed as subscript for solely typographical reasons. Subscripts are typically rendered with a lowered baseline using smaller text.

How do you add superscript in HTML?
The tag defines superscript text. Superscript text appears half a character above the normal line, and is sometimes rendered in a smaller font. Superscript text can be used for footnotes, like WWW. Tip: Use the tag to define subscript text.
What is the HTML tag for superscript text?
: The Superscript element The HTML element specifies inline text which is to be displayed as superscript for solely typographical reasons. Superscripts are usually rendered with a raised baseline using smaller text.
